Rayalaseema Soaked: Heavy Showers Drench the Region, Setting New Rainfall Records

Estimated reading time: 2 minutes

Rayalaseema, the southern region of Andhra Pradesh, finds itself at the mercy of relentless downpours, causing widespread disruptions and recording substantial rainfall figures in various areas. Sullurpeta in the Tirupati district takes the lead, reporting an astounding 20cm of rainfall, signaling the severity of the weather conditions.

In the neighboring areas, Tada, also in the Tirupati district, closely follows with 19cm of rainfall, while Gudur records 14cm and Srikalahasti 13cm. Thottambedu, another region in the Tirupati district, mirrors Srikalahasti’s figures with 13cm of rainfall.
